I’ve got 2015 GTI however doesn’t seem to be getting hot enough when the heaters are on full,

I’ve checked the Heater Core / Matrix pipes and both return and inlet are boiling hot. I’ve check the heater flap motor and it’s moving as it should & calibrated it via the controls. The car seems to get hotter when I have the fan speeds set lower / say set to 4. So the heat isn’t as hot when the blowers are on full.

Monitored via obd and coolant temperature is 212 degrees

Could it be a thermostat or heater control valve?

Yep, as said  sounds like the Matrix, mine was the same I also needed to have the Aux  Heater pump replaced as it was not working. The matrix was clogged up and you can not flush them as they have a bypass.
